Output 21c520998c839543f74737bc8bd56cfda3ea93e75257ca0ca5021d15a5c44aae:0

value
10735322
script pubkey
OP_0 OP_PUSHBYTES_20 ad54c52a692de3dd24c34707540c73cb78c34343
address
bc1q442v22nf9h3a6fxrgur4grrneduvxs6rfvc4rm
transaction
21c520998c839543f74737bc8bd56cfda3ea93e75257ca0ca5021d15a5c44aae
confirmations
376590
spent
true